About This Classic 1987 Edition
"Monarchy: Behind the Scenes with the Royal Family" by Brian Hoey offers an intimate look into the lives of the British Royal Family. Published by St. Martin's Press in New York in 1987, this First U.S. Edition provides a unique perspective on the monarchy, featuring photography by Tim Graham. Brian Hoey, known for his detailed accounts of royal life, delves into the personal and public aspects of the royal family, making this work a valuable resource for enthusiasts and historians alike.
